Pick the Right Influencers: Not All Stars Shine Equally
First rule: relevance beats follower count. A lifestyle vlogger with half a million subs might look flashy, but if they never talk slots or poker, your brand becomes background noise. Look for niche creators who livestream casino nights, drop strategy tips, or host live giveaways. Their audience already breathes the same air you want to fill.
Micro vs. Macro: The Hidden Power Play
Micro influencers (10k‑50k followers) act like a tight‑knit crew. Engagement spikes; comments feel like personal notes. Macro personalities (500k+) offer reach, but their audiences are diluted, often skim‑reading sponsored content. Blend both—micro for depth, macro for breadth. The chemistry creates a ripple that spreads across platforms.

Legal Tightrope: Stay Compliant
Regulations for gambling promos are stricter than a dealer’s rule book. Influencers must disclose sponsorships, age‑gate content, and avoid targeting minors. Draft clear guidelines, provide compliant copy, and run a quick legal scan before launch. Skipping this step? You’ll be watching your brand go bust faster than a losing hand.
Tracking Success: Metrics That Matter
Clicks and impressions? Yesterday’s news. Focus on conversion rate, cost per acquisition, and lifetime value of players brought in by each influencer.
